Article 5 – Your rights

5.1. Right to access and inspect:

You have the right to access your personal data and to be informed about how we use your personal data, at any time and free of charge.

5.2. Right of rectification, erasure and restriction:

You are free to choose whether or not to share your personal data with Molse Bouwmachines. Furthermore, you always have the right to request that we improve, supplement, or delete your personal data. You acknowledge that if you refuse to provide data or request its deletion, certain services will not be available. You may also request to restrict the processing of your personal data.

5.3. Right of objection:

You also have the right to object to the processing of your personal data for serious and legitimate reasons.

Furthermore, you always have the right to object to the processing of personal data for direct marketing purposes; in such a case, you do not need to provide any reasons.

5.4. Right to data portability:

You have the right to obtain and/or transfer your personal data, processed by us, in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format.

5.5. Right to withdraw consent:

As far as the processing is based on your prior consent, you have the right to withdraw that consent.

Article 9 – Cookies

9.1. What are cookies?

A “cookie” is a small file sent by the Molse Bouwmachines server and placed on your computer's hard drive. The information stored on these cookies can only be read by us and only during the duration of your visit to the website.

9.2. Why do we use cookies?

Our website uses cookies and similar technologies to distinguish your usage preferences from those of other users of our Website. This helps us to provide you with a better user experience when you visit our website and also allows us to optimise our website.

As a result of recent legislative changes, all websites targeting specific parts of the European Union are required to ask for your consent to use or store cookies and similar technologies on your computers or mobile devices. This cookie policy provides you with clear and complete information about the cookies we use and their purpose.

9.3. Types of cookies:

Although there are different types of cookies, distinguished by functionality, origin or retention period, legislation primarily distinguishes between functional or technically necessary cookies on the one hand and all other cookies on the other.

What cookies do we use? In short:
1. Functional cookies or necessary cookies 
Functional cookies ensure that our website functions correctly. This includes saving your browser settings so that you can view our website optimally on your screen.

2. Analytical cookies
The Molse Bouwmachines website uses Google Analytics, a web analytics service provided by Google Inc. (“Google”). Google Analytics uses "cookies" to help analyse how visitors use the website. By measuring website usage, we can continue to improve our website for the benefit of our users. Among other things, they give us insight into how often we are visited and where we can improve our website. This way, we ensure that the experience with our website is continuously optimised.
